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Ash Rust | Blue-spotted Comet Darner |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Fungi (Fungi)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Basidiomycota (Club Fungi)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Pucciniomycetes (Pucciniomycetes)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Pucciniales (Pucciniales) | Odonata (Odonata) |
| Family | Pucciniaceae | Aeshnidae |
| Genus | Puccinia | Anax |
| Species | Puccinia sparganioidis | Anax concolor |
